Output dd67908b0faddb62303875cf15b7530b9aac9c6e7ea291958ad5d5780361975c:0

value
9535294
script pubkey
OP_0 OP_PUSHBYTES_20 38889542cf508b4d18531f9a14c9fd250a84a0cf
address
bc1q8zyf2sk02z956xznr7dpfj0ay59gfgx0c2w9va
transaction
dd67908b0faddb62303875cf15b7530b9aac9c6e7ea291958ad5d5780361975c
confirmations
287244
spent
true